Abstract

The utility model discloses a kind of low noise axial fan, comprise: main cylinder, be arranged on the wheel member of described main cylinder inside and be arranged on the motor of described main cylinder inside, described motor is fixed on main cylinder inside by support, described wheel member is sleeved on the output shaft of described motor, the internal surface of described main cylinder has interior anti-corrosion layer, the internal surface of described interior anti-corrosion layer has interior sound-absorption layer, the outer surface of described main cylinder has outer anti-corrosion layer, the outer surface of described outer anti-corrosion layer has outer sound-absorption layer.By the way, the utility model is simple and reasonable, and be applicable to the place that some blower fan use amounts are large, noise is little, can reduce noise pollution.

Background technique
Axial-flow blower, purposes widely, is exactly air-flow equidirectional with the axle of fan blade, and as electric fan, air-conditioning outer machine fan is exactly that axial flow mode runs blower fan.Why being called " axial flow ", is because gas is parallel to fan shaft flowing.Axial fan is used in the occasion that traffic requirement is higher and pressure requirements is lower usually.Existing noise of axial flow fan is comparatively large, also needs to improve.

Embodiment
Be clearly and completely described to the technological scheme in the utility model embodiment below, obviously, described embodiment is only a part of embodiment of the present utility model, instead of whole embodiments.Based on the embodiment in the utility model, those of ordinary skill in the art are not making other embodiments all obtained under creative work prerequisite, all belong to the scope of the utility model protection.
Refer to Fig. 1 and Fig. 2, the utility model is embodiment comprise:
A kind of low noise axial fan, comprise: main cylinder 1, be arranged on the wheel member 2 of described main cylinder 1 inside and be arranged on the motor 3 of described main cylinder 1 inside, it is inner that described motor 3 is fixed on main cylinder 1 by support, described wheel member 2 is sleeved on the output shaft of described motor 3, the internal surface of described main cylinder 1 has interior anti-corrosion layer 4, the internal surface of described interior anti-corrosion layer 4 has interior sound-absorption layer 5, the outer surface of described main cylinder 1 has outer anti-corrosion layer 6, the outer surface of described outer anti-corrosion layer 6 has outer sound-absorption layer 7, described interior sound-absorption layer 5 and outer sound-absorption layer 7 have good sound-absorbing effect, noise pollution can be reduced, described interior anti-corrosion layer 4 and outer anti-corrosion layer 6 improve the decay resistance of main cylinder 1.
Preferably, described interior sound-absorption layer 5 and outer sound-absorption layer 7 all adopt mineral wool acoustic board, and described mineral wool acoustic board is bonded on the inside and outside wall of main cylinder 1 respectively.
Preferably, described interior anti-corrosion layer 4 and outer anti-corrosion layer 6 are zinc coat.
